The Ultimate Guide to Paper Hand Towel Dispenser Installation

Ensuring a seamless and effective installation of paper hand towel dispensers is crucial for maintaining hygiene and convenience in various settings. Whether in commercial spaces, public facilities, or residential areas, the proper installation of these dispensers contributes significantly to their functionality. This comprehensive guide outlines key steps and considerations for achieving the ultimate paper hand towel dispenser installation.

1. Selecting the Right Location

Choosing the optimal location for your paper hand towel dispenser is the first step in the installation process. Consider high-traffic areas, proximity to sinks or washbasins, and accessibility for all users. Ensure that the dispenser is mounted securely at a convenient height, keeping in mind ADA compliance guidelines for accessibility.

2. Gathering Necessary Tools and Materials

Before beginning the installation, gather all the necessary tools and materials. Typical items include a drill, screws, anchors, a level, and, of course, the paper hand towel dispenser itself. Confirm that the dispenser model aligns with the intended mounting surface and has the appropriate hardware for installation.

3. Checking Wall Surface Suitability

Inspect the wall surface where the dispenser will be mounted. Ensure that it is sturdy enough to support the dispenser’s weight and the force applied during usage. If the wall is not suitable, consider using wall anchors or choosing an alternative location.

4. Determining Mounting Height and Orientation

Determine the optimal mounting height for the paper hand towel dispenser based on user convenience. Generally, a height of 48 to 54 inches above the floor is recommended. Additionally, decide on the dispenser’s orientation, whether it should be mounted vertically or horizontally, depending on the available space and aesthetic preferences.

5. Marking and Leveling

Use a level to mark the desired location for mounting the dispenser. This ensures a straight and even installation. Make precise markings for drill holes, taking into account any specific instructions provided by the dispenser manufacturer.

6. Drilling and Securing the Dispenser

Carefully drill holes at the marked locations, making sure to use the appropriate drill bit for the wall material. Insert anchors if necessary, and securely fasten the dispenser using the provided screws. Double-check the level during the installation process to ensure proper alignment.

7. Loading Paper Towels and Testing

Once the dispenser is securely mounted, load it with the appropriate paper hand towels according to the manufacturer’s instructions. Test the dispenser to ensure smooth and efficient operation. Adjust any settings, such as sensor sensitivity or sheet length, as needed.

8. Regular Maintenance and Inspection

Establish a routine for regular maintenance and inspection of the paper hand towel dispenser. This includes checking for paper levels, ensuring proper sensor functionality (if applicable), and addressing any issues promptly. Regular maintenance enhances the longevity and performance of the dispenser.
